I understand that with Intel Arch, fpc/Lazarus "Windows" programs will simply run in Win 10 IOT Core (and a colleague of mine already tested that his Delphi programs do run on Win 10 IOT Core on a MinowBoard Max.) What about Win 10 IOT Core for ARM ? I suppose that some work needs to be done to support Win 10 IOT Core on ARM. We found that Win IOT sirs not support the GDI winapi. Nonetheless Delphi "Service Applications" do run normally, while normal Delphi applications can't show a Form. But Win IOT does support DirectX so a GUI would be possible, if the "Widgets" are provided by the application itself.
